summaryrefslogtreecommitdiff
path: root/libbcachefs.c
diff options
context:
space:
mode:
Diffstat (limited to 'libbcachefs.c')
-rw-r--r--libbcachefs.c4
1 files changed, 4 insertions, 0 deletions
diff --git a/libbcachefs.c b/libbcachefs.c
index 123109f8..82f131cf 100644
--- a/libbcachefs.c
+++ b/libbcachefs.c
@@ -728,6 +728,10 @@ dev_names bchu_fs_get_devices(struct bchfs_handle fs)
n.label = read_file_str(fs.sysfs_fd, label_attr);
free(label_attr);
+ char *durability_attr = mprintf("dev-%u/durability", n.idx);
+ n.durability = read_file_u64(fs.sysfs_fd, durability_attr);
+ free(durability_attr);
+
darray_push(&devs, n);
}